Four tries for Parsons in Counties' romp


Otley’s Steve Parsons scored four tries today as England Counties collected their biggest winning margin since they were founded 29 matches ago in 2002 when they beat a Korea President’s XV 108-10.

The tourists scored 16 tries in a free-flowing romp in which all their training ground work came to fruition in spectacular style to eclipse their previous best victory – a 76-10 win over Russia in France two years ago.

“The opposition wasn’t as strong as we were expecting really, but we did what we had to do and executed well.” said forwards’ coach Dave Baldwin.

“Our finishing was exceptional. Very clinical. The game got a bit scrappy at times, but we managed to pull it back and get the structure back into our game.

“We have to be cautious in assessing the performance because we know that we have tougher games ahead in Japan.

“We need to keep our feet firmly on the ground and continue to work hard in training.”

Otley centre Kyle Dench, a second-half replacements, also scored.
